Lines Matching refs:policy_dbs
68 struct policy_dbs_info *policy_dbs = policy->governor_data; in generic_powersave_bias_target() local
69 struct od_policy_dbs_info *dbs_info = to_dbs_info(policy_dbs); in generic_powersave_bias_target()
70 struct dbs_data *dbs_data = policy_dbs->dbs_data; in generic_powersave_bias_target()
117 struct policy_dbs_info *policy_dbs = policy->governor_data; in dbs_freq_increase() local
118 struct dbs_data *dbs_data = policy_dbs->dbs_data; in dbs_freq_increase()
138 struct policy_dbs_info *policy_dbs = policy->governor_data; in od_update() local
139 struct od_policy_dbs_info *dbs_info = to_dbs_info(policy_dbs); in od_update()
140 struct dbs_data *dbs_data = policy_dbs->dbs_data; in od_update()
150 policy_dbs->rate_mult = dbs_data->sampling_down_factor; in od_update()
161 policy_dbs->rate_mult = 1; in od_update()
174 struct policy_dbs_info *policy_dbs = policy->governor_data; in od_dbs_update() local
175 struct dbs_data *dbs_data = policy_dbs->dbs_data; in od_dbs_update()
176 struct od_policy_dbs_info *dbs_info = to_dbs_info(policy_dbs); in od_dbs_update()
185 if (sample_type == OD_SUB_SAMPLE && policy_dbs->sample_delay_ns > 0) { in od_dbs_update()
199 return dbs_data->sampling_rate * policy_dbs->rate_mult; in od_dbs_update()
244 struct policy_dbs_info *policy_dbs; in sampling_down_factor_store() local
255 list_for_each_entry(policy_dbs, &attr_set->policy_list, list) { in sampling_down_factor_store()
260 mutex_lock(&policy_dbs->update_mutex); in sampling_down_factor_store()
261 policy_dbs->rate_mult = 1; in sampling_down_factor_store()
262 mutex_unlock(&policy_dbs->update_mutex); in sampling_down_factor_store()
298 struct policy_dbs_info *policy_dbs; in powersave_bias_store() local
311 list_for_each_entry(policy_dbs, &attr_set->policy_list, list) in powersave_bias_store()
312 ondemand_powersave_bias_init(policy_dbs->policy); in powersave_bias_store()
349 return dbs_info ? &dbs_info->policy_dbs : NULL; in od_alloc()
352 static void od_free(struct policy_dbs_info *policy_dbs) in od_free() argument
354 kfree(to_dbs_info(policy_dbs)); in od_free()
430 struct policy_dbs_info *policy_dbs; in od_set_powersave_bias() local
441 policy_dbs = policy->governor_data; in od_set_powersave_bias()
442 if (!policy_dbs) in od_set_powersave_bias()
447 dbs_data = policy_dbs->dbs_data; in od_set_powersave_bias()